Rasasi Abeer is a proper head-turner, divisive for some, but if you're after a full-throttle, creamy woody-rose experience with serious staying power, this is your jam. Forget subtlety; this is an all-out, unapologetic Arabian odyssey.
This one is a properly divisive beast. Some find it a screechy, old-fashioned aldehyde bomb, while others are utterly enchanted by its smoky, sweet, and masculine edge. Definitely sample before you commit.

Occasions
Given its strong oriental character and the high likelihood of robust performance (often associated with woody-ambery scents), Abeer is best suited for evening formal events or a date where you want to make an impression. Its intensity would likely be too much for an office setting or casual daytime wear.

Occasions
Its enormous sillage and potent aldehydic-oriental profile make it too much for the office. It hits all the right notes for a date or formal event, offering a mysterious and intriguing presence. For casual wear, a light hand is needed to avoid overwhelming.
